Understanding Life Insurance

Life insurance is a contract between an individual and an insurance company, where the insurer agrees to pay a designated beneficiary a sum of money upon the death of the insured person. This financial safety net ensures that your family is protected from financial hardship in the event of your untimely demise. Maxx Life Insurance offers various types of life insurance policies, each designed to cater to different life stages and financial goals.

Types of Maxx Life Insurance Policies

Maxx Life Insurance provides a variety of policies to suit different needs. Here are some of the most popular options:

  • Term Life Insurance: This is a straightforward and affordable option that provides coverage for a specified period, typically ranging from 10 to 30 years. If the insured person passes away within this term, the beneficiaries receive a death benefit.
  • Whole Life Insurance: This type of policy offers lifelong coverage and includes a cash value component that grows over time. It provides both a death benefit and a savings element, making it a versatile choice for long-term financial planning.
  • Universal Life Insurance: This policy combines the benefits of term and whole life insurance. It offers flexible premiums and death benefits, allowing policyholders to adjust their coverage as their needs change.
  • Endowment Plans: These plans are designed to provide a lump sum payment at the end of a specified term or upon the death of the insured. They are often used as savings and investment tools.

Choosing the Right Maxx Life Insurance Policy

Selecting the right life insurance policy involves considering several factors:

  • Assess Your Needs: Determine the amount of coverage you need based on your financial obligations, such as mortgages, loans, and future expenses like education.
  • Budget Considerations: Evaluate your budget to decide on the premiums you can afford. Term life insurance is generally more affordable than whole or universal life insurance.
  • Policy Duration: Consider the length of coverage you require. Term life insurance is ideal for short-term needs, while whole and universal life insurance offer lifelong protection.
  • Additional Riders: Explore additional riders that can enhance your policy, such as critical illness coverage or accidental death benefits.

Here is a table to help you compare the different types of Maxx Life Insurance policies:

Policy Type Coverage Duration Cash Value Premiums
Term Life Insurance 10-30 years No Fixed
Whole Life Insurance Lifetime Yes Fixed
Universal Life Insurance Lifetime Yes Flexible
Endowment Plans Specified term Yes Fixed

What is the difference between term and whole life insurance?

+

Term life insurance provides coverage for a specified period, typically 10 to 30 years, and does not include a cash value component. Whole life insurance offers lifelong coverage and includes a cash value that grows over time, making it a more comprehensive option.

What happens if I outlive my term life insurance policy?

+

If you outlive your term life insurance policy, the coverage expires, and you will not receive any benefits. However, some policies offer the option to convert to a permanent policy or renew the term, depending on the terms and conditions of your specific plan.
